Output 5d3aaf63a51ccae71110ddd8e3c3ef9f6b8b54ce1a3a3bf579fb8cdeec41dc42:0

value
2681752
script pubkey
OP_HASH160 OP_PUSHBYTES_20 65d68f6cbcdc1af308d15624b71358cd4baba643 OP_EQUAL
address
3AyVCpt7PULpKqQvHGMUWwFux3BxHi2Bgk
transaction
5d3aaf63a51ccae71110ddd8e3c3ef9f6b8b54ce1a3a3bf579fb8cdeec41dc42
spent
true